DescriptionMark Gibbons produced some of the richest black and white interior work for GW back in the mid 90s. This piece is for Nagash, somewhat famous for the botched attempt to replicate the design in their miniature line.Measures about 12.5 by 17 inches. Despite being black and white this piece has more presence than most painted pieces I have seen. The artist managed to build depth in the painting by using different media with different degrees of gloss, elevating certain elements visually. The detail is truly phenomenal.
